## Break-Glass: Gatewing Rate Limiter

If the Gatewing internal API gateway begins rejecting support tooling with 429s during an incident, you may bypass the per-team rate limits using break-glass mode. This disables quota enforcement for 30 minutes and pages the on-call platform engineer automatically. Use it only when ticket triage is blocked. To activate, open the override console and enter the recovery passphrase shown below.

unlock words, fafop-hawep: briwyn-oliix-sorox

Subject: Returned demo units — Kestrel 9 tablets

Dispatch desk,

Six Kestrel 9 demo tablets are boxed and ready at the Farrow Street showroom for return to the Ambleton depot. All units are wiped and tagged; the box is taped and labelled RETURN/DEMO. Please schedule a pickup before Thursday and make sure the driver's coordinator passes on the hand-over instruction below.

courier memo of yawep-yafog: the pramir ulaix courier leaves the ulavan aldix frair zorok oliiel joreth rusdor fenvan ledger at gate 1305 under passcode 514738

## Releases

Report exports in Ledgerloom are always generated in UTC internally, then converted to the workspace timezone at render time. Never bake a local offset into the export job itself — that caused the Brindlemark incident, where DST transitions duplicated an entire day's rows. Before tagging a release, verify `tz_render_spec.md` matches the converter version, and run the fixture suite across at least three offset-change dates. Release tarballs must be signed before upload; the signing key is provided below.

deploy key for kajof-fajop: bky6_gDHw9Q

Subject: Scheduled key rotation — Fanout Relay API

Dear plugin authors,

As part of our ongoing work on notification fan-out backpressure in the Pulsewright platform, we are rotating the credentials used by the Relaymere delivery tier. Plugins that publish through the fan-out queue must adopt the new credential before the old one is retired next Tuesday; after that, publishes will be rejected rather than buffered, by design. For your convenience, the replacement credential is provided directly below.

API key for kahop-bagef: zpat2_yb